Abstract

This article provides a comprehensive analysis of the dynamics of migration processes, tracing the historical trajectory of human movements from the earliest dispersals out of Africa to the formation of modern transnational flows. The study examines key stages in the development of migration—from the initial migrations of Homo sapiens and the Neolithic transition to sedentary lifestyles, through migration waves in the ancient and medieval periods, to the eras of industrialization and globalization in the 20th–21st centuries. Particular attention is paid to the influence of economic, political, cultural, and ecological factors on migration processes, along with proposals for the effective management of contemporary migration challenges. By adopting an interdisciplinary approach, the article offers an integrated understanding of how migration has shaped societal development and transformed cultural-demographic structures.
